Director of Sales, FindLaw - NTO
The Director, Sales builds strategy and leads a team of sales managers to achieve overall sales and revenue growth goals. Success is achieved through driving performance accountability within the team and effective partnership with sales leadership and internal support teams such as marketing, commercial excellence, human resources and finance.
About the Role
In this opportunity as Director of Sales, FindLaw - NTO you will:
Drives growth and sales of print and digital products with a focus on expansion of current customer average order values and net new customers.
Closely manages sales and renewal pipeline health and development, with clear metrics and accountabilities, and brings rigorous sales process and coaching to create sales excellence
Collaborates by building effective partnerships with sales leadership and internal support teams such as marketing, commercial excellence, human resources and finance
Leads a team of Regional Sales Managers in pipeline management, including forecasting revenue accurately and implementing effective growth and staging strategies.
Close and consistent utilization of all CRM systems and myriad operational data and reports
Active talent and succession pipeline management to ensure coverage of quota and improve organizational effectiveness in client-centricity, customer value messaging, rapid decision making

About You
You're a fit for the role of Director of Sales, FindLaw - NTO if your background includes:
Bachelor's degree REQUIRED, MBA or JD preferred
8+ years' experience in sales
5+ years' experience in sales management
Experience with digital marketing products REQUIRED
Excellent leadership skills with a focus on driving accountability and building an empowered, highly effective management team
Strategic thinking skills; effective account planning, sales negotiation and closing skills
Ability to work effectively in a fast paced, rapidly changing technology environment, and to complete multiple projects simultaneously
Knowledge of legal markets, legal information needs and online legal products preferred
